Our database holds 2 NHTSA owner-reported complaints for the 1989 Dodge Dodge Truck. Each one is a report filed by an owner or driver and published by NHTSA without most of them being verified. A complaint is not a confirmed defect, not a recall and not a manufacturer bulletin. Narratives are shown exactly as filed.
Complaints are reports submitted by owners and drivers to NHTSA. They are not verified and do not establish that a defect exists.
Showing 1–2 of 2
WHILE DRIVING STEERING WHEEL BROKE AT GEAR BOX WITH NO WARNING, CAUSING CONSUMER TO HIT A CURVE.*AK
FUEL TANK WAS MANUFACTURED WITH PARTS OTHER THAN METAL WHICH ARE CAPABLE OF BEING PUNCTURED BY OBJECTS ON ROAD. FUEL TANK WAS PUNCTURED BY A FOREIGN OBJECT WHILE DRIVING AND LEAKED FUEL. *AK
